    Generic Name Acetazolamide
    Brand Names Diamox, Diamox Sequels
    Drug Class Carbonic anhydrase inhibitor
    Indications Glaucoma, epilepsy, altitude sickness, edema, periodic paralysis
    Route Of Administration Oral, intravenous
    Mechanism Of Action Inhibits carbonic anhydrase enzyme, reducing bicarbonate formation
    Common Side Effects Tingling, loss of appetite, vomiting, drowsiness, confusion
    Contraindications Severe kidney disease, liver disease, allergy to sulfa drugs
    Pregnancy Category C (use with caution)
    Half Life About 10-15 hours
    Molecular Formula C4H6N4O3S2
    Storage Conditions Store at room temperature away from moisture and heat

    What Sets Acetazolamide Apart from Other Choices

    A common impression is that all tablets for pressure or fluid retention look the same, but life experience says otherwise. I’ve seen people on other diuretics struggle with sudden swings in potassium, debilitating cramps, or just plain not getting relief from their symptoms. Acetazolamide, with its carbonic anhydrase inhibition, attacks a different link in the biological chain. Instead of pushing kidneys to flush everything out, it tweaks how the body balances acids and bases. This subtle difference matters. For someone with glaucoma, this changes eye pressure in a way most standard water pills simply can’t, and for mountaineers or travelers who suddenly develop headaches at altitude, this pill cracks the problem open before it spirals into something dangerous.

    You’ll spot people taking medications like furosemide for heart issues or hydrochlorothiazide for blood pressure. Those drugs won’t help with high-altitude headaches or stubborn eye pain caused by pressure. Acetazolamide’s sweet spot sits between these worlds—it won’t replace all other diuretics, but it fits gaps left by every other solution I’ve watched patients try over the years.

    Hard Truths About Adverse Effects

    No medication escapes the reality of trade-offs. With acetazolamide, the most common things I hear about are tingling in the hands or feet and a persistent odd taste with carbonated drinks. For people with kidney stones or pre-existing kidney issues, careful monitoring and conversations matter. Nobody likes to point out downsides, but real experience dictates that ignoring these warnings isn’t just risky—it’s unfair to the patient. Doctors regularly order blood tests for electrolytes during long-term use, and patients are advised to stay hydrated, as the risk of kidney stones can creep higher.

    Unlike steroid-based treatments, acetazolamide rarely brings the wild mood changes or intense hunger seen with prednisone, and unlike strong diuretics, it doesn’t generally torch potassium to dangerously low levels. This kind of predictability wins out for busy clinicians who don’t want to gamble on bigger risks, and for patients who prefer steady rather than dramatic changes in their daily routine.

    Comparing Acetazolamide to the Competition

    This isn’t a world where one pill fits all. Look at glaucoma, for example: some patients do best with prostaglandin analogues, others with beta blockers. But when things get rough and the pressure refuses to drop, systemic agents like acetazolamide step in with real, measurable results. The same holds for high-altitude illness. Oxygen and patience help, but neither hit the cellular mechanisms the way acetazolamide does.

    Taking other diuretics at altitude often backfires, worsening dehydration and the effects of low oxygen. Acetazolamide, by shifting the body’s acid-base equation, helps drive deeper breaths and counterbalances the carbon dioxide changes at altitude. That experience isn’t just in textbooks. Climbers, miners, guides, and doctors across continents bank on it every day.
